The radar detection is useful as they just spray it down the line and it is easy to detect. However, it's the laser which is almost unavoidable like others said. It's because it is a focused beam (well, more focused than radar) and they actually target a person with it and shoot rather than just waiting for someone to pass through the beam. So, the only way to detect it ahead of time is if they are out of range or you catch an incident reflection... but, their range is REALLY far (I think like >1000ft), so your best chance is a reflection which is also not very likely. Usually you end up getting the blazing alarm after you're already screwed :)
